What is Kintock and what services does it provide?

Kintock is a private organization that provides reentry and transitional services for individuals reentering society after incarceration. The company operates residential reentry centers and offers programs such as employment assistance, substance abuse treatment, and educational support. Kintock partners with government agencies to help reduce recidivism and support successful community reintegration. Their services aim to help clients develop the skills and resources needed for a successful transition.

What are some common challenges faced by employees working at Kintock, and how can they be addressed?

Employees at Kintock, which specializes in reentry and community corrections services, often face challenges such as managing high caseloads, maintaining clear boundaries with clients, and responding to crisis situations. Staff must balance providing support and guidance to individuals transitioning from incarceration with enforcing program rules and ensuring community safety. To address these challenges, Kintock typically offers thorough training, support from experienced supervisors, and opportunities for teamwork and debriefing. Building strong communication skills and resilience can help employees navigate the complexities of the role and foster a positive work environment.

About Whitsons Culinary Group

Sourced by ZipRecruiter

Whitsons Culinary Group, located in Islandia, NY, US, operates in the food service industry, offering a diverse range of services including school nutrition, residential and healthcare dining, prepared meals, emergency dining, and culinary education. First established in 1979, the family-owned company has built a reputation for its bespoke catering services, committed to delivering nutritionally balanced, tastefully diverse and quality assured meals. The company embraces a mission to enrich life one meal at a time, underlined by a focus on food quality, health, wellness, superior service, and social responsibility.
